Japan faces fiscal concerns amid rising bond yields and regional debt issues

Japan faces significant fiscal and economic discussions regarding rising interest rates and government debt. Recent reports highlight that 10-year government bond yields have reached levels not seen in nearly 30 years, sparking debates over the true risks to national finances, particularly if a stronger yen coincides with rising rates.

In regional news, Hyogo Prefecture has been designated as a ‘debt issuance permission entity,’ meaning it requires national government approval to issue local bonds. This follows a rise in its real debt service ratio above the 18% threshold, driven by past large-scale investments and rising interest costs.
